    You are taking the bank to court, you can't expect to turn up at court and say I made a mistake or your case will be thrown out.

    You can amend your claim on MCOL by paying £35, phone them up and find out what you should do.

    My son recently went accidently overdrawn abroad with one Abbey account and got stung with £100 bank charges. He followed Martyn's first step which was to talk to the bank and managed to convince them to drop all charges, bit by bit. He has a very healthy business account with them also which he threatened to withdraw. So please talk especially if it's your 1st time of going overdrawn.
